Your Powhatan, VA Questions Answered

How often should I re-mulch my garden beds in Powhatan? +
As a general guideline, organic mulches such as shredded hardwood, pine bark, or cedar typically need to be refreshed or topped up every 1 to 2 years to maintain the optimal 2-4 inch depth.
What's the best type of mulch for effective weed control in VA? +
An organic mulch like shredded hardwood applied at a proper depth of 2 to 4 inches is highly effective, creating a formidable barrier that suffocates germinating weeds.
When is the optimal time to plant new shrubs or trees in Powhatan, VA? +
Fall and early spring are considered the most favorable times, allowing plants to establish robust root systems before intense heat or deep cold sets in.
Do you remove old mulch before installing new? +
If the existing layer is excessively thick, compacted, or shows signs of rot, we recommend removal. Otherwise, a fresh top dressing is often sufficient.
